My approach to therapy

I'm warm, curious, and direct. I won't just nod and reflect your words back at you. My approach is humanistic at its core: I believe you are fundamentally capable of growth, and my job is to help you access that. I draw on attachment theory to understand the relational patterns that shape how you connect (or disconnect) with the people in your life, and I use Solution Focused Brief Therapy to keep us grounded in where you want to go, not just where you've been. I'm also strength-based, meaning we'll spend real time identifying what's already working in you, even when everything feels broken. Sessions are collaborative, honest, and often a little lighter than people expect therapy to be.
